The Legacy of ‘Halo’

Since its debut in 2001, the ‘Halo’ franchise has become a cultural phenomenon, defining the first-person shooter genre with its blend of epic storytelling, revolutionary mechanics, and engaging multiplayer modes. Fans of the series have eagerly awaited each new installment, with the latest entry, ‘Halo Infinite,’ promising to be the most ambitious entry yet.

The Story So Far

‘Halo Infinite’ takes place in a new setting, the eponymous Halo ring, and follows the journey of the Master Chief as he faces off against the Banished, a group of rogue aliens. The game promises a return to the series’ roots with a more open-world approach to level design, giving players more freedom to explore and tackle missions in their own way.

The Gameplay

The gameplay of ‘Halo Infinite’ has been described as a “spiritual reboot” of the series, with a focus on simplifying mechanics and emphasizing player choice. Players will now have access to a grappling hook, allowing them to traverse the environment more quickly and creatively. The game will also feature a day/night cycle, with enemies and objectives changing depending on the time of day.

Multiplayer Modes

‘Halo’ is known for its robust multiplayer offerings, and ‘Halo Infinite’ is no exception. The game will feature the classic modes fans have come to love, such as Team Deathmatch and Capture the Flag, as well as new modes like Big Team Battle and Academy, where players can hone their skills before jumping into the main multiplayer offerings.

The Soundtrack

The soundtracks of the ‘Halo’ series have always been a standout feature, and ‘Halo Infinite’ is no exception. The game will feature an original score by Gareth Coker, known for his work on ‘Ori and the Blind Forest’ and ‘Ori and the Will of the Wisps.’

The Future of ‘Halo’

‘Halo Infinite’ looks to be a promising return to form for the series, with a renewed focus on storytelling and gameplay that fans have been clamoring for. The game will also launch on Xbox Game Pass, giving players the opportunity to experience the title for a fraction of the cost. With ‘Halo’ celebrating its 20th anniversary next year, it’s clear that the franchise is still going strong and has a bright future ahead.
